HMCS Saskatchewan (DDE 262)
HMCS ''Saskatchewan'' was a that served in the Royal Canadian Navy (RCN) and later the Canadian Forces. She was the second Canadian naval unit to bear the name . The ship was named for the Saskatchewan River which runs from Saskatchewan to Manitoba in Canada. Entering service in 1963, she was mainly used as a training ship on the west coast. She was decommissioned in 1994 and sold for use as an artificial reef. She was sunk as such in June 1997 off British Columbia. Design The ''Mackenzie'' class was an offshoot of the design. Saskatchewan River
The Saskatchewan River ( Cree: ''kisiskāciwani-sīpiy'', "swift flowing river") is a major river in Canada. It stretches about from where it is formed by the joining together of the North Saskatchewan and South Saskatchewan Rivers to Lake Winnipeg. It flows roughly eastward across Saskatchewan and Manitoba to empty into Lake Winnipeg. Through its tributaries the North Saskatchewan and South Saskatchewan, its watershed encompasses much of the prairie regions of Canada, stretching westward to the Rocky Mountains in Alberta and north-western Montana in the United States. Including its tributaries, it reaches to its farthest headwaters on the Bow River, a tributary of the South Saskatchewan in Alberta. Description It is formed in central Saskatchewan, approximately east of Prince Albert, by the confluence of its two major branches, the North Saskatchewan and the South Saskatchewan, at the Saskatchewan River Forks. Babcock & Wilcox Boiler
A high pressure watertube boiler (also spelled water-tube and water tube) is a type of boiler in which water circulates in tubes heated externally by the fire. Fuel is burned inside the furnace, creating hot gas which boils water in the steam-generating tubes. In smaller boilers, additional generating tubes are separate in the furnace, while larger utility boilers rely on the water-filled tubes that make up the walls of the furnace to generate steam. The heated water/steam mixture then rises into the steam drum. Here, saturated steam is drawn off the top of the drum. In some services, the steam passes through tubes in the hot gas path, (a superheater) to become superheated. Superheated steam is defined as steam that is heated above the boiling point at a given pressure. Superheated steam is a dry gas and therefore is typically used to drive turbines, since water droplets can severely damage turbine blades. Keel Laying
Laying the keel or laying down is the formal recognition of the start of a ship's construction. It is often marked with a ceremony attended by dignitaries from the shipbuilding company and the ultimate owners of the ship. Keel laying is one of the four specially celebrated events in the life of a ship; the others are launching, commissioning and decommissioning. In earlier times, the event recognized as the keel laying was the initial placement of the central timber making up the backbone of a vessel, called the keel. As steel ships replaced wooden ones, the central timber gave way to a central steel beam. Modern ships are most commonly built in a series of pre-fabricated, complete hull sections rather than around a single keel. The event recognized as the keel laying is the first joining of modular components, or the lowering of the first module into place in the building dock. Mark 46 Torpedo
The Mark 46 torpedo is the backbone of the United States Navy's lightweight anti-submarine warfare torpedo inventory and is the NATO standard. These aerial torpedoes are designed to attack high-performance submarines. In 1989, an improvement program for the Mod 5 to the Mod 5A and Mod 5A(S) increased its shallow-water performance. The Mark 46 was initially developed as Research Torpedo Concept I (RETORC I), one of several weapons recommended for implementation by Project Nobska, a 1956 summer study on submarine warfare. Torpedo Tube
A torpedo tube is a cylindrical device for launching torpedoes. There are two main types of torpedo tube: underwater tubes fitted to submarines and some surface ships, and deck-mounted units (also referred to as torpedo launchers) installed aboard surface vessels. Deck-mounted torpedo launchers are usually designed for a specific type of torpedo, while submarine torpedo tubes are general-purpose launchers, and are often also capable of deploying mines and cruise missiles. Most modern launchers are standardized on a diameter for light torpedoes (deck mounted aboard ship) or a diameter for heavy torpedoes (underwater tubes), although other sizes of torpedo tube have been used: see Torpedo classes and diameters. NATO
The North Atlantic Treaty Organization (NATO, ; french: Organisation du traité de l'Atlantique nord, ), also called the North Atlantic Alliance, is an intergovernmental military alliance between 30 member states – 28 European and two North American. Established in the aftermath of World War II, the organization implemented the North Atlantic Treaty, signed in Washington, D.C., on 4 April 1949. NATO is a collective security system: its independent member states agree to defend each other against attacks by third parties. During the Cold War, NATO operated as a check on the perceived threat posed by the Soviet Union. The alliance remained in place after the dissolution of the Soviet Union and has been involved in military operations in the Balkans, the Middle East, South Asia, and Africa. Mark 44 Torpedo
The Mark 44 torpedo is a now-obsolete air-launched and ship-launched lightweight torpedo manufactured in the United States, and under licence in Canada, France, Italy, Japan and the United Kingdom, with 10,500 being produced for U.S. service. It was superseded by the Mark 46 torpedo, beginning in the late 1960s. The Royal Australian Navy, however, continued to use it alongside its successor for a number of years, because the Mark 44 was thought to have superior performance in certain shallow-water conditions. It has been deployed by many navies and air forces including the USN, Royal Navy, Royal Australian Navy and the Royal Air Force from various launch vehicles. These include long-range maritime patrol aircraft, e.g. P-3 Orion, RAF Nimrod, Canadair Argus, LAMPS and other embarked naval helicopters, ASROC missiles, Ikara missiles. Mark 43 Torpedo
The 10" Mark 43 torpedo was the first and smallest of the United States Navy light-weight anti-submarine torpedoes. This electrically propelled 10-inch (25-cm) torpedo was 92 inches (2.3 m) long and weighed 265 pounds (120 kg). Described as "a submersible guided missile", the torpedo was designed for air or surface launch. The Mod 0 configuration was designed for launch from helicopters or fixed-wing aircraft, and the Mod 1 configuration was for helicopters only. Both were electrically driven and deep-diving, but had relatively short range. They were classified as obsolete in the 1960s. Limbo (weapon)
Limbo, or Anti Submarine Mortar Mark 10 (A/S Mk.10), was the final development of the forward-throwing anti-submarine weapon Squid, designed during the Second World War and was developed by the Admiralty Underwater Weapons Establishment in the 1950s. Limbo was installed on the quarterdeck of Royal Navy escort ships from 1955 to the mid-1980s, Australian–built destroyer and s. Limbo was widely employed by the Royal Canadian Navy, being incorporated into all destroyer designs from the late 1950s to the early 1970s, including the , , , and classes and the Type 12 President Class frigates built for the South African Navy in the 1960s. Operation Limbo was loaded and fired automatically with the crew under-cover and was stabilised in pitch and roll. The firing distance of the mortars was controlled by opening gas vents; rounds could be fired from . Anti-submarine Warfare
Anti-submarine warfare (ASW, or in older form A/S) is a branch of underwater warfare that uses surface warships, aircraft, submarines, or other platforms, to find, track, and deter, damage, or destroy enemy submarines. Such operations are typically carried out to protect friendly shipping and coastal facilities from submarine attacks and to overcome blockades. Successful ASW operations typically involved a combination of sensor and weapon technologies, along with effective deployment strategies and sufficiently trained personnel. Typically, sophisticated sonar equipment is used for first detecting, then classifying, locating, and tracking a target submarine. Sensors are therefore a key element of ASW. Common weapons for attacking submarines include torpedoes and naval mines, which can both be launched from an array of air, surface, and underwater platforms. Vickers
Vickers was a British engineering company that existed from 1828 until 1999. It was formed in Sheffield as a steel foundry by Edward Vickers and his father-in-law, and soon became famous for casting church bells. The company went public in 1867, acquired more businesses, and began branching out into military hardware and shipbuilding. In 1911, the company expanded into aircraft manufacture and opened a flying school. They expanded even further into electrical and railway manufacturing, and in 1928 acquired an interest in the Supermarine. Beginning in the 1960s, various parts of the company were nationalised, and in 1999 the rest of the company was acquired by Rolls-Royce plc, who sold the defence arm to Alvis plc. The Vickers name lived on in Alvis Vickers, until the latter was acquired by BAE Systems in 2004 to form BAE Systems Land Systems.
